A firebomb severely damaged a bar in Montreal North early Wednesday and forced the temporary evacuation of dwellings above the establishment.
Montreal police said the incident occurred at 5:15 a.m. at a on Fleury St. near St-Michel Blvd. No injuries were reported.

Witnesses said that just prior to the fire they heard the sound of breaking glass and saw a car carrying one or several people speeding away from the scene.
Fleury St. is closed between St-Michel Blvd. and J.J.-Gagnier St. as investigators examine the site.
